On September 11th, 2001, the world was changed forever. Four airlines were hijacked by members of/people affiliated with the extremist Islamic terrorist group; al-Qaeda. The September 11 attacks are the most devastating terrorist attacks in the world's history, killing approximately 3,000 people and caused about $10 billion worth of property and infrastructural damage. Two commercial airliners were deliberately flown into the World Trade Center Towers (twin towers) in New York City, a third plane - was flown into the Pentagon (headquarters of the United States Department of Defense) in Arlington County, Virginia, killing 125 Pentagon personnel and all 64 people on board the flight. The fourth plane however, was originally intended to strike the United States Capitol, but instead crashed in a field in Stonycreek Township near Shanksville, Pennsylvania due to the passengers on the aircraft trying to overcome the hijackers. This tragic event has become commonly known around the world as '9/11'.
At 7:59am on the morning of Tuesday, September 11th, 2001; American Airlines Flight 11, a Boeing 767 carrying 81 passengers and 11 crew members, departs 14 minutes late from Logan International Airport in Boston, for Los Angeles International Airport (LAX). At approximately 8:13am, American Airlines Flight 11 had its last routine contact with the FAA's Boston Center. Statements have been made that this is when the hijacking of the flight begun, when the hijackers Waleed and Wail al-Shehri rise from seats 2A and 2B and stab two flight attendants. Mohamed Atta then rises from seat 8D and approaches the cockpit. Within minutes, he is at the controls. While this is all going on, there is a second plane - United Airlines Flight 175, another fully fueled Boeing 767, carrying 56 passengers and nine crew members, also departs from Logan International Airport in Boston; its destination too was LAX. Five hijackers are aboard this flight, one of them communicated with Mohammed Atta shortly before American Airlines Flight 11's takeoff. At 8:19am, Betty Ong - a flight attendant on board American Airlines Flight 11 panicked and alerted American Airlines via air phone; "The cockpit is not answering, somebody’s stabbed in business class—and I think there’s Mace—that we can’t breathe—I don’t know, I think we’re getting hijacked.” She then informs American Airlines of the stabbings of two flight attendants. After this, the five hijackers turned off the plane's transponder and then sent a message to Air Traffic Controllers (ATC) which was only intended for the cabin; "Eh..... We have some planes. Just stay quiet, and you'll be okay. We are returning to the airport." it is believed that Atta mistakenly pressed a button which directed his voice to radio rather than to the cabin. Just a few seconds later, Atta's voice says "nobody move. Everything will be okay. If you try to make any moves, you'll endanger yourself and the airplane. Just stay quiet". At 8:46am on September 11, 2001; hijacked American Flight 11 plummets into the north face of the North Tower of the World Trade Center (WTC), between floors 93 and 99 at approximately 790km/h. Everybody on the plane was killed instantly, along with those people on floors 93-99 of the North Tower.
The second hijacking was of United Airlines Flight 175, another Boeing 767 carrying 56 passengers and nine crew members. Flight 175 took off from Logan International Airport in Boston; it too was headed for Los Angeles. There were five hijackers aboard this flight, also believed to be members of the terrorist group al-Qaeda. It is also said that one of those five hijackers communicated with Mohammed Atta (one of the five hijackers on board American Airlines Flight 11) shortly before American Airlines Flight 11's takeoff. At 8:37am, United Airlines Flight 175 confirmed a sighting of American Airlines Flight 11 to flight controllers, the hijacked plane was roughly 10km (16 miles) to the South of United Airlines Flight 175. Soon after, between 8:42-8:46am, United Airlines Flight 175 is hijacked. These hijackers were believed to have used knives, mace and threatening the use of bombs on the passengers on board the flight. They used the knives to stab the flight attendants aboard the flight, the two pilots were also killed. At 8:58am, Flight 175 took a turn off course just like American Airlines Flight 11, and headed for New York City. Just five minutes later at 9:03am, United Airlines Flight 175 crashes at approximately 950km/h into the South Tower of the WTC between floors 77 and 85. Just like American Airlines Flight 11, all people on board the flight were killed instantly on impact along with the unknown hundreds of people on floors 77-85. Due to the first attack occurring earlier, there were many broadcasting networks and media organizations covering the terrifying sight of the attack, which resulted in millions of television viewers witnessing the second attack first hand.
The destruction of the twin towers had a huge impact on people in New York especially, but also everyone else in the world. People in the towers themselves were so frightened they felt they were forced to jump what could have been hundreds of floors to their death. After the plane struck the second tower, the streets of New York were filled with silver clouds of sobering smoke. The atmosphere was filled with an eerie sadness and heartbreak. It took a total of just 56 minutes for the South Tower of the WTC to collapse after the impact of United Airlines Flight 175 and a total of 102 minutes for the North Tower to collapse after being struck by American Airlines Flight 11. Apparently, it took no longer than 12 seconds for the towers to fall.

The third hijacking was of American Airlines Flight 77; a Boeing 757 carrying 58 passengers and six crew members. This flight departed from Washington Dulles International Airport in Fairfax and Loudoun Counties, Virginia for LAX at 8:20am. Just like the other two flights, there were five hijackers aboard. Somewhere between 8:50-8:54am, Flight 77 was hijacked and just like the other two fatal flights, the use of mace and knives were imminent. Just after the hijacking occurred, American Airlines Flight 77 deviates from its assigned course turning south over Ohio. 10 minutes after the North Tower of the WTC was hit, the hijackers turn off Flight 77's transponder and even primary radar contact with the aircraft is lost which is unlike the other two hijacked planes. Flight 77 then turns east which goes unnoticed by flight controllers due to the radar blackout. When the radar is finally restored at 9:05am, flight controllers desperately search west of Flight 77's previous position but are unable to find it. American Airlines Flight 77 flies undetected for a total of 36 minutes, heading due east towards the Nation's Capitol - Washington D.C. At 9:37am, American Airlines Flight 77 strikes the western side of the Pentagon at 835km/h, starting a blazing fire. All 64 people on board the flight are killed, along with 125 Pentagon personnel.
The final hijacking was on United Airlines Flight 93; another Boeing 757 which departed from Newark International Airport (now Newark Liberty International Airport) for San Francisco International Airport at 8:42am, 40 minutes late due to congested runways. It's initial flight path takes it close to the World Trade Center which at this time is three minutes away from being struck. The four hijackers aboard this flight take over the controls at 9:28am, this hijacking is overheard by flight controllers in Cleveland: "ladies and gentlemen, here is the captain... please sit down... keep remaining sitting. We have a bomb on board". Flight 93 then reverses over Ohio and starts flying towards the east. After some passengers on board the flight phoned their families and learned of the attacks in New York City, the passengers on board the plane decide to fight back against the hijackers - this passenger revolt begins at 9:57am. Sadly, at 10:03am, United Airlines Flight 93 is crashed by it's hijackers and passengers at 926km/h due to fighting in the cockpit, near Shanskville, Pennsylvania.
After the investigation of the attacks begun, the 19 hijackers were identified and they were all in fact a part of the terrorist group al-Qaeda. Their leader Osama Bin Laden, a very wanted man by the United States Government was found in hiding on May 2nd 2011, and was then executed by US troops.
The attacks of September 11, 2001, resulted in the deaths of about 3,000 innocent people. 9/11 made everyone in the United States and all around the world aware of terrorism and caused sadness and heartbreak for a very long time. Even today, 13 years since the devastating attacks, pain and sorrow is all that is felt when the topic comes up. It was a very sobering event in the world's history and will never be forgotten.
